Frances Turner Stroud, 74, of Biloxi, MS died Sunday, August 29, 2010 at Canon Hospice in Gulfport, MS. Frances was born in Chatom, Washington County, Alabama, to her father, John Halron Stroud and her mother, Mary Binion Turner Stroud. She later moved to Biloxi, MS and worked at Keesler Air Force Base until her retirement. She had many close friends in both Biloxi, MS and Alabama.
Frances is survived by her cousins, Edward Powell Turner, Jr. and Mary Binion Jones, and their children, Halron W. Turner, Frank C. Turner II, E. Tatum Turner, Benjamin Edward Jones, Elizabeth Jones Mitchell and Binion Jones, along with cousins from her father's family, Dorothy Shuford, Ed McLemore and John McLemore.
